Schooling Alternatives
Distance Education With distance education, parents follow the Department of Education's curriculum and reproduce school at home. It's only one form of home schooling. For more information go to: http://www.distance.vic.edu.au
Doxa School Bendigo This school provides supported education for students 11-14 years of age who are having difficulty remaining in their regular school. For more information contact John Russell Ph: 54428140 http://www.doxa.org.au/
Home Schooling There are people in Bendigo who have chosen various forms of home schooling. It's useful to know that you don't have to follow the Department of Education's curricullum, if you choose home schooling. For local support go to: Homeschooling Victoria http://www.home-ed.vic.edu.au/
Net School - Bendigo NETschool aims to re-engage young people (15-20 years) who are experiencing difficulties with mainstream schooling. It's an annexe of Bendigo Senior Secondary College. Phone: 5441 8504
Transitions
Into Kindergarten
- Preschool Field Workers - These workers support children with additional needs in preschool programs.
- Inclusion in Kindergarten Services - this initiative is for children with severe disabilities in kindergartens. For more information on either of these services contact: St Lukes Ph: 5440 1100
Into Primary School
- The Department of Human Services - Specialist Children's Services offer transition support into primary school. Contact: Phone 5444 9999
